## Deployment

Quick notes for the sync: the Crashloft pipeline ships as a single container that ingests mobile crash reports from the Pintail SDK, symbolicates them, and drops summaries into the triage queue. Deploys are blue-green — push the image, flip the alias, watch the dashboard for five minutes before walking away. Symbolication workers scale horizontally, so bump the replica count if the backlog chart climbs. Everything else is driven by the config block, reproduced here for reference.

service settings:
[pelius]
port = 5432
team = praius
host = pelius.crelvoforge.internal
region = upper-4
access_code = ac_8f224d
timeout_ms = 2000

The Orvane Labs bike cage and the east and west parking gates operate on separate access schedules, and facilities desk staff should note that visitor vehicles may only use the west gate between 07:00 and 19:00. Cyclists requesting cage access must show a valid day pass, and their details should be entered in the access ledger before the cage is opened. Gates must never be propped open, even briefly, during deliveries. When a manual override is required at either gate, use the code below.

staff pass of fadup-fawig = bdg-FUNKS-4

## Deployment

SpinCubby handles locker access for WashPort sites. Deploy via the standard pipeline; no manual steps. Support note: access tokens expire fast by design — if a customer reports a dead QR code, have them re-request from the kiosk. Rollbacks are safe; locker state lives upstream in HampsterDB. The service reads its runtime settings from the block below at boot.

service settings:
PRAIX_LOG_LEVEL=error
PRAIX_METRICS_HOST=metrics.praix.qorvelcorp.corp
PRAIX_POOL_SIZE=16

Onboarding note: LiftLogic simulator access

Support staff use the LiftLogic elevator-dispatch simulator to reproduce customer dispatch complaints. Load the customer's building profile, replay the reported time window, and attach the resulting trace to the ticket. Simulator state resets nightly, so export traces before end of shift. On first launch the simulator will ask for the team passphrase shown below.

vault phrase of taweg-kafof = oliax-zorael